One of the many attractions in owning a freshwater aquarium is the fact that you can approximate the looks and conditions of the natural habitat of your freshwater fish. Aside from the natural sand, rocks and other decorative items, freshwater aquarium live plants complete the natural atmosphere within the tank.

Aside from making your aquarium look great, the live plants have other benefits for your fish. Foremost of these is the fact that they produce oxygen which your fish needs and in turn absorb carbon dioxide and ammonia which are harmful to them.

This miniature ecosystem in your aquarium is also beneficial to the fish in other terms. It means less stress because of the secure environment for them to hide, explore and live on. (Some fish are herbivores and sometimes use the plants as one of their food supplements.)

Plants For Your Tank

There is some need to do research on what plants you want and what plants is best in combination with the fish species you had chosen. be careful because some plants can harm certain fish species so simply ask a store clerk for a compatibility chart.)

Some plants are easier to take care of than others. Some plants need more light while others need more oxygen and many also need to be near the top of the aquarium while others are fine on the bottom of the tank. There are many of them that are hardy, though. (java ferns, vallesneria, hygrophila, etc.)

The following are some of the more popular aquarium plants. They are popular because of their looks, their color, their sturdy nature and their value in the total ecosystem within your tank.

Cabomba

With its fan-shaped leaves, Cabomba (Carolina Fanwort) is a fast-growing live aquarium plant that provides the much-needed shade to your fishes. It is also used as a good hiding place as well as providing materials for spawning.
